Executive Networks
The Centre for National Security (CNS) brings together executives from public and private sector organizations to help improve Canada’s ability to address national security and public safety challenges. The CNS works to make recommendations about and improve threat detection, response coordination, the free movement of low-risk people and trade, and communication with the public. The Council on Emergency Management (CEMT) is a national forum that focuses on effective operational practices and key strategic issues related to emergency management. The Council provides valuable networking, learning, and leadership development opportunities for individuals responsible for emergency management and operational continuity who are focused on maximizing resilience within their organizations. The Council also enables members to broaden their understanding of risk factors and to exchange insights. The Council for Security Executives (CFSE) is a national forum that provides valuable networking, learning, and leadership development opportunities for senior security executives focused on maximizing resilience within their organizations. The Council enables members to broaden their understanding of risk factors and to exchange insights. The Senior Executive Health and Safety Leadership Charter is an initiative that involves CEOs and other leaders focused on and dedicated to improving health and safety for their organizations and communities. The Charter provides a series of guiding principles in health and safety endorsed by an Executive, CEO, or Senior Official of their company, organization, association, or department. Leadership Charter signatories realize the vital link between a culture of health and safety and a successful organization, and are united in their vision and support for a safer, healthier, more prosperous Canada.
